Numbering disappears when a document is saved
In Word 2003 I have recently found that numbering disappears when I save a
document and then re-open it. Is there something I can adjust? |

Numbering disappears when a document is saved
In Tools | Templates and Add-Ins, make sure that "Automatically apply

My suggestion was to clear the option, not select it. Clearing it prevents
styles to be updated from the attached template, which could affect any aspects of formatting, not just numbering. In this case, I'm not sure what the problem could be. Note that using the Numbering button does not give you much control. It will
be safer to set up numbering carefully linked to style(s). For single-level numbering, you can apply the List Number style, which you can modify to suit your needs (if necessary).
